Football

Football, also known as soccer in some countries, is a team sport played between two teams of eleven players each. The objective of the game is to score goals by getting a spherical ball into the opposing team’s net, which is achieved primarily by using any part of the body except for the hands and arms (goalkeepers are an exception, as they can use their hands within a designated area).

The game is played on a rectangular field with a goal at each end and is governed by a set of rules known as the Laws of the Game. Matches are typically divided into two halves, each lasting 45 minutes, with stoppage time added at the referee’s discretion.

Football is one of the most popular sports worldwide, with a significant following and numerous professional leagues and tournaments, including domestic leagues and international competitions like the FIFA World Cup. The sport emphasizes skills such as dribbling, passing, and tactical teamwork, and it fosters a strong sense of community and national pride among players and fans alike.
